Crystalline aminoorganosilanes - Syntheses, structures, spectroscopic properties
Meinel, Birgit,Guenther, Betty,Schwarzer, Anke,Boehme, Uwe
, p. 1607 - 1613 (2014)
A number of aminosilanes derived from N-methylaniline and chloroorganylsilanes were prepared and characterized. X-ray structure analysis was performed on the crystalline derivatives Ph(Cl)Si(NMePh)2 (4a), HSi(NMePh)3 (2b), MeSi(NMePh)3 (3b), and Ph 2Si(NMePh)2 (6b). The compounds were comprehensively characterized by 1H, 13C, 29Si NMR, and IR spectroscopy. Volatile derivatives were further characterized by GC/MS. It was shown using quantum chemical methods that the planarization of the nitrogen atoms in the amino derivatives is caused by phenyl groups and silyl substituents. Copyright
Synthesis of N-[chloro(diorganyl)silyl]anilines
Nikonov,Sterkhova,Lazareva
, p. 883 - 887 (2014/07/22)
A series of N-[chloro(diorganyl)silyl]anilines RR′Si(NR'Ph)Cl (R, R′ = Me, Ph, CH2=CH, ClCH2, Cl(CH2) 3; R' = H, Me) was prepared via the reaction of diorganyldichlorosilanes with aniline or N-ethylaniline in the presence of triethylamine.
